Renhao Fan is a rising researcher in computer architecture, whose work focuses on enabling efficient, parallel execution of deep neural networks (DNNs) on resource-constrained platforms. His key research areas include many-core architectures, in-memory computing, and hardware acceleration for artificial intelligence. Fan’s most notable contribution is the development of MAICC, a lightweight many-core architecture that integrates in-cache computing to support multi-DNN parallel inference. This design addresses the growing demand for flexibility and performance in autonomous driving and intelligent robotics, where diverse neural networks must run simultaneously. By moving computation into the cache hierarchy, MAICC reduces data movement overhead and energy consumption, offering a scalable solution for real-time AI workloads.
